Transaction 75fbcbbdd2ed45eba936270fd872f57370f161a2dc169918f4165c4e4ff4fb28

6 Input
1 Outputs
  • 75fbcbbdd2ed45eba936270fd872f57370f161a2dc169918f4165c4e4ff4fb28:0
  • value  1611267
    address  3LwRkWu4fZduvUFAt5tVSvJUWECnSNcpFN